1. Gentle Dependent Resistor (LDR)
A lightweight Dependent Resistor (LDR), also known as a photoresistor, is actually a style of resistor that alterations its resistance depending on the amount of mild it can be subjected to. The greater mild that falls around the LDR, the lower its resistance turns into, and vice versa. This property tends to make LDRs ideal for use in devices that have to detect or react to varying light-weight ranges.

How an LDR Operates:
Resistance and light-weight: In darkness, an LDR provides a significant resistance (often within the megaohms assortment), but as gentle depth will increase, the resistance decreases. This enables far more existing to pass through the circuit.
Construction: LDRs are made out of semiconductor products like cadmium sulfide, which show photoconductivity (a lessen in resistance when exposed to light).
Programs of LDRs:
Automatic lights devices: Streetlights and backyard garden lights can mechanically turn on when it receives dim through the use of an LDR to sense the reduction in ambient light-weight.
Brightness Regulate: LDRs are sometimes Employed in gadgets like automatic brightness changes in smartphones and tv screens.
Solar purposes: LDRs are generally Utilized in solar power-related units to track the Solar's intensity.

three. Mild Emitting Diode (LED)
The Light Emitting Diode (LED) is usually a semiconductor light supply that emits light-weight when an electrical current flows by means of it. LEDs are incredibly efficient, consuming far considerably less Electricity than traditional incandescent bulbs and supplying extended lifespans.

How an LED Is effective:
Semiconductor junction: LEDs are made from a p-n junction semiconductor. When ahead voltage is used over the diode, electrons within the n-type area recombine with holes while in the p-variety location, releasing Electrical power in the shape of light.
Colours: The color in the emitted mild is determined by the semiconductor materials employed. Widespread LED shades include things like pink, inexperienced, blue, and white.
Benefits of LEDs:
Strength efficiency: LEDs use less power in comparison with standard lighting solutions.
Longevity: By using a lifespan typically exceeding 50,000 hrs, LEDs outlast incandescent and fluorescent bulbs.
Eco-friendly: LEDs never incorporate hazardous products like mercury, generating them safer for the environment.
Apps of LEDs:
Lighting: LEDs are Utilized in residential, professional, and industrial lights because of their performance and durability.
Shows: LED know-how powers displays in equipment like smartphones, televisions, and billboards.
Indicators: LEDs are commonly applied as indicator lights in a variety Light Emitting of Digital units, such as personal computers, electrical power materials, and family appliances.
